Visualizing Signals: Gauges and Indicators
The real game-changer here is the ability to see what was previously hidden inside redstone wires. The mod introduces analog gauges that display signal strength visually, making it easy to debug circuits without guessing values through trial and error.
- Analog Gauges: These devices provide a continuous visual representation of the current power level, essential for tuning complex machinery.
- Digital Indicators: Clear LED-style lights replace vague redstone dust trails with distinct signals. You can customize their colors using dyes to visually separate different signal lines in crowded industrial builds.
This visual feedback loop is critical for multiplayer servers where team members need to troubleshoot mechanisms quickly without endless chat messages about broken circuits.
Crafting Precision with Detectors and Timers
Beyond simple on/off switches, this mod expands your toolkit with specialized detectors. Block category sensors allow you to automate harvesting cycles by detecting specific ores or wood types instantly. Entity detectors track the movement of villagers, animals, or hostile mobs within a defined radius.
Timers add another layer of complexity and utility. You can synchronize events based on real-world time intervals or in-game tick counts without building massive clockwork structures. This is invaluable for creating scheduled maintenance routines for your automated farms or timed lighting systems that mimic day-night cycles naturally.

Built-in Wireless Connectivity and Specialized Sensors
The mod introduces wireless relay systems and receivers, enabling signal transmission between distant structures without the need for long strings of redstone dust. This feature is particularly useful for connecting remote outposts to a central control hub or triggering defensive mechanisms across large map areas.
Sensors That See Everything
Specialized sensors like seismic detectors and sensitive glass allow you to react to vibrations, trapdoors being opened remotely, or even subtle environmental changes. These blocks open up new possibilities for creating hidden rooms that only activate when a specific condition is met.
